Thanasis Papagiannou is one of the first winemakers to understand and promote the idea that wine should retain its unique characteristics, which are derived from the grape variety, the specific location of the vineyard, and the methods employed by the viticulturist to maintain biological balance. Papagiannou owns an extensive estate of vineyards spread across various areas of Nemea, where he has planted the grape variety best suited to each location to perfectly match the specific conditions.
Organoleptic Characteristics:
Papagiannou Estate Chardonnay Fume exhibits a vibrant golden color and rich aromas of white flowers, marzipan, butter caramel, pineapple, and banana. On the palate, it is well-structured and full-bodied, with a noticeable sweetness that is beautifully balanced, leaving a long and satisfying finish.
Pairings:
It pairs excellently with stuffed cabbage rolls, salads with boiled vegetables, lobster, and pork with white or lemon-based sauces. Best served at 10-12°C.
